Following ConExpo, Global Cranes returned to Houston and reported the show was the most successful in the company’s history. Global Cranes said it sold more than $12 million worth of its American-designed Zoomlion RT and crawler crane lines. While Global had sales that spanned the entire line, while the standout machines were the Zoomlion RT100 rough-terrain crane and the new Zoomlion ZCC1100H crawler crane.

The Zoomlion RT100 has a maximum capacity of 110 tons, 141 ft. of main boom, and a jib that extends up to 60 ft. The ZCC1100H crawler also has a capacity of 110 tons with 220 ft. of boom and a 59-ft. jib. Both cranes, along with the entire the Zoomlion RT and crawler lines, were designed in the United States using name-brand components and competitive charts. In addition, Global Crane says every crane it sells has the lowest pricing for its class in the industry.

To fill existing orders and cut down on lead times for future requests, Global agreed with Zoomlion at ConExpo to take immediate delivery of 60 rough-terrain cranes across their entire line, as well as 10 ZCC1100H crawlers. These cranes will be available shipping from either Houston or the San Francisco Bay Area in the coming months.
